There are 2 major kinds of skylights readily available for acquisition and installment: curb-mounted and deck-mounted. Curb installed needs visit site a box structure for the system to establish upon.

Glass skylights, being bad insulators, add to warm loss throughout Buffalo's winters, causing greater home heating expenses. Energy-efficient models with low-E layers, dual or three-way glazing, and appropriate insulation minimize warmth transfer. Appropriate installment with reliable securing protects against air leakages. Incorrect installment of skylights raises the threat of leakages, possibly causing water damage, spots, and mold and mildew growth.
Usually, the ideal skylight incline is your geographical latitude plus 5-15 levels. In Buffalo (latitude 42 degrees), the optimal skylight slope is 47-57 degrees.
One more great product is polycarbonate skylights, which are extremely long lasting and virtually unbreakable. They are light-weight and can be molded right into bent layouts. Polycarbonate obstructs 99% of UV rays, stays clear without yellowing, and is the most affordable skylight choice readily available. Yes, skylights significantly boost all-natural light in an area.

Some types of skylights can open, permitting fresh air to stream in and stagnant air to flow out. This all-natural air flow assists boost the air quality inside your home, removing odors and decreasing humidity buildup (Rooflights). This is particularly valuable in kitchen areas and shower rooms where the air can become full of vapor or smoke
